Nestled within the shimmering waters of the Andaman Sea, Langkawi beckons travelers with its captivating allure. This archipelago of 99 picturesque islands off the coast of northwestern Malaysia offers an idyllic escape filled with breathtaking landscapes, pristine beaches, and cultural treasures.

1. Pantai Cenang (Cenang Beach)

Kick off your Langkawi adventure at Pantai Cenang, the island's most popular beach. With its powdery white sands, crystal-clear waters, and vibrant atmosphere, Cenang Beach is per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and indulging in water sports. As the sun sets, the beach transforms into a lively hub with bustling night markets, bars, and restaurants.

2. Underwater World Langkawi

Immerse yourself in the wonders of the aquatic realm at Underwater World Langkawi. This state-of-the-art aquarium houses over 5,000 marine creatures representing more than 100 species. Marvel at the graceful manta rays, majestic sharks, and playful penguins as you navigate through tunnels and underwater walkways.

3. Langkawi SkyBridge

Ascend to breathtaking heights on the Langkawi SkyBridge. Spanning 125 meters over the rainforest canopy, this curved suspension bridge offers panoramic views of the surrounding islands and the vast Andaman Sea. Conquer your fear of heights and embark on a thrilling adventure that will create unforgettable memories.

4. Pulau Payar Marine Park

Escape to the pristine waters of Pulau Payar Marine Park, a marine sanctuary teeming with coral reefs, colorful fish, and marine turtles. Snorkel or dive amidst this underwater paradise and encounter a dazzling array of marine life. The crystal-clear waters provide excellent visibility, making it an ideal spot for underwater exploration.

5. Kilim Geoforest Park

Venture into the heart of Langkawi's ancient rainforest at Kilim Geoforest Park. This UNESCO Global Geopark is home to a vast network of mangroves, limestone cliffs, and emerald-green lakes. Embark on a serene boat tour through the mangrove channels, spot fascinating wildlife, and marvel at the towering limestone karsts that have shaped the landscape over millions of years.

6. Eagle Square

Unveiling the heartbeat of Langkawi, Eagle Square (Dataran Lang) is a grand open space dominated by a majestic statue of a soaring eagle. This iconic landmark symbolizes the island's freedom and sovereignty. Capture a memorable photo with the eagle as a backdrop and soak up the vibrant atmosphere surrounding the square.

7. Oriental Village

Transport yourself to a world of art, culture, and history at Oriental Village. This cultural theme park showcases traditional architecture and crafts from various Asian countries, including Malaysia, Thailand, China, and Japan. Admire the intricate carvings, wander through the colorful shops, and indulge in delicious international cuisine.

8. Mahsuri's Tomb

Discover the tragic tale of Mahsuri, a legendary princess who is believed to have been falsely accused and executed for adultery. Visit her tomb, located in the quaint village of Kampung Mahsuri, and learn about the legend that has captivated generations of Langkawians.

9. Mount Mat Cincang

Embark on a scenic hike to the summit of Mount Mat Cincang, the highest peak on Langkawi Island. As you ascend through the rainforest, you'll be rewarded with bre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. At the summit, enjoy a picnic or simply marvel at the panoramic vistas.

10. Dayang Bunting Island

Sail to the enchanting Dayang Bunting Island, also known as the Island of the Pregnant Maiden. This uninhabited island is adorned with a stunning lake that is said to resemble a reclining pregnant woman. Take a boat tour around the island, marvel at its unique rock formations, and enjoy swimming in the crystal-clear waters.
